Villalbarba is a municipality located in the province of Valladolid, Castile and León, Spain. According to the 2004 census, the municipality had a population of 156 inhabitants. Villalbarba is situated 3 km southeast of Romangordo.

Benafarces is a municipality located in the province of Valladolid, Castile and León, Spain. According to the 2004 census, the municipality had a population of 114 inhabitants. Benafarces is situated 5 km west of Romangordo.
